Scuro Mountain vs Dimbokro Climate & Distance Between

Ivory Coast flag
  • The distance between Scuro Mountain, Italy and Dimbokro, Ivory Coast is approximately 4,203 km or 2,612 mi.
  • To reach Scuro Mountain in this distance one would set out from Dimbokro bearing 27°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Scuro Mountain bearing 35.7° or NE .
  • Scuro Mountain has a Mediterranean warm climate (Csb) whereas Dimbokro has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Scuro Mountain is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ome whereas Dimbokro is in or near the tropical dry for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 20.1 °C (36.2°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 12.3 °C (22.1°F) more in Scuro Mountain.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 282.9 mm (11.1 in) less which is equivalent to 282.9 l/m² (6.94 US gal/ft²) or 2,829,000 l/ha (302,439 US gal/ac) less. About 3/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23.6° lower in Scuro Mountain than in Dimbokro.
